Lykke Li Release 'Love Me Like I'm Not Made of Stone' Video

03/05/2014
.
(Radio.com) Eighties hair-metal rockers, eat your heart out, because Swedish pop crossover Lykke Li just announced her new album I Never Learn, in which she says every track is a "power ballad."

Not that there will be much in the way of musical similarity. I Never Learn is released May 6 in North America (May 5 internationally) on LL/Atlantic Records and one listen to its lead-off single "Love Me Like I'm Not Made of Stone" assures as much. I Never Learn definitely looks like a break-up record. Also a "slow dance; a slow burner," Lykke said.

"I wrote [one song] in Sweden when I was packing up my s-, and I'd just gotten out of a relationship and it was a horrible time," she said. "I just had the hurt, shame, sadness, guilt, longing."

The video for "Love Me Like I'm Not Made of Stone," directed by Tarik Saleh, is basically one long, unbroken close up of Lykke, reminiscent of Sinead O'Connor's video for "Nothing Compares 2U".

The album was co-produced by Lykke, Bj�rn Yttling of Peter Bj�rn and John and GRAMMY-award winning producer Greg Kurstin.
